First Lady Senator Oluremi Tinubu, through her Renewed Hope Initiative (RHI), has distributed empowerment tools to 500 women in Niger State under the Sustainable Development Goals/Renewed Hope Initiative Women Empowerment Programme, aimed at helping them start or expand small businesses. Items distributed included deep-chest freezers, gas cookers, generators, and industrial grinders. Represented by Hajiya Fatima Bago, the First Lady emphasized that empowering women strengthens families and society. Similarly, in Anambra State, Mrs. Tinubu, represented by Dr. Nonye Soludo, distributed farm tools and resources to 200 trained farmers under the Renewed Hope Initiative Agricultural Support Programme. Beneficiaries received items such as piglets, organic fertilisers, poultry tools, and farming equipment after training in areas like drip irrigation, piggery, and poultry farming. Both events underscored the First Lady's commitment to economic empowerment and self-reliance for women and farmers across Nigeria.
